Method for alive preservation and transportation of sea cucumber

The invention relates to a method for alive preservation and transportation of sea cucumber, which belongs to the technical field of aquatic products. The method comprises the following steps: holding the transported sea cucumber (naturally fished and caught or artificially cultured) for at least two days, transferring the sea cucumber with strong vitality after holding into a cooling barrel which is disinfected in advance and contains filtered sea water for performing cooling treatment, then placing into a plastic bag (a small sponge after being soaked in the sea water at the temperature of 20 DEG C is arranged in the bag), exhausting the air in the bag, enabling the bag to be rapidly filled with oxygen, binding up a bag mouth, and boxing; loading two layers or three layers or four layers in each heat insulation box, determining according to the size of the sea cucumber and the size of space in each box, separating the layers by hardboards, using foam boards to support at the middle parts, preventing the plastic bag from being damaged by extrusion and further avoiding death caused by hypoxia of the sea cucumber or oppression on the sea cucumber; placing the upper layer of the hardboard into a bag which loads ice blocks in advance or a heat insulation bottle for heat insulation; and sealing with an adhesive tape after well boxing, marking and starting the transportation as soon as possible. By adopting the method, the survival rate of the sea cucumber during the transportation is effectively improved, and the transportation cost is reduced.

Method for extracting ultra-low-ash-content pure coal from coal slime

The invention discloses a method for extracting ultra-low-ash-content pure coal from coal slime. The method comprises the following steps: ball-milling slurrying, specifically, milling coal slime until particles with less than 200 meshes occupy more than 90%, and controlling the mass percent concentration of the coal slime slurry to be 10-35%; grading, specifically, conveying the particles with less than 200 meshes to a flotation step; flotation, specifically, adding a collecting agent, a foaming agent and an inhibitor in the obtained coal slime slurry, uniformly mixing, and carrying out one-time rough flotation, two sections of three-to-six-time fine flotation and one section of three-to-six-time scavenging to obtain refined coal slurry I, refined coal slurry II and tailing coal slurry respectively; and dehydration, specifically, adding a flocculant in the refined coal slurry I, the refined coal slurry II and the tailing coal slurry which are obtained through the flotation, carrying out flocculation settling, then dehydrating by virtue of an ultrahigh-pressure pressure filter, and controlling a pressure filter pressure to be 4.5-5.5Mpa, thus obtaining ultra-low-ash-content pure coal products, common refined coal products and tailing coal products. The method disclosed by the invention is simple in process flow, and capable of efficiently extracting the ultra-low-ash-content pure coal products from the coal slime; and moreover, the water contents of the obtained coal products are low and can achieve less than 15%, thus the coal products have remarkable economic benefits and environmental protection value.

Nanometer emulsion blocking agent used for drilling fluid, and preparation method and application thereof

The invention relates to a nanometer emulsion blocking agent used for drilling fluid, and a preparation method and application thereof. The nanometer emulsion blocking agent is prepared through polymerization by dispersing at least two double-bond-contained monomers into water containing an emulsifier and a co-emulsifier in an weak alkali environment under the action of a catalyst; and raw materials participating in reaction comprise, by weight, 40 to 60 parts of the double-bond-contained monomers, 2 to 6 parts of the emulsifier, 1 to 4 parts of the co-emulsifier, 0.1 to 0.5 part of the catalyst and 30 to 50 parts of the water. Accordingn to the invention, a particle size of a dispersed particle in the nanometer emulsion blocking agent is distributed in a nanoscale and is less than 500 nm, so the nanometer emulsion blocking agent has good blocking effect, cen block micropores and be casted into microcracks, and is capable of reducing pore pressure transmission, maximumly reducing differential pressure sticking and effectively inhibiting hydration dispersion of clay; the nanometer emulsion blocking agent is stable in high salinity and has the advantages of convenient use, no toxicity, no pollution and easy degradation; and the preparation method of the nanometer emulsion blocking agent has the advantages of reasonable process, mild and controllable conditions, no post treatment, low cost and benefit ratio, and facilitation to industrial production.

Hot mix asphalt pavement smoke suppressant and preparation method of smoke-suppressing asphalt

The invention discloses a hot mix asphalt pavement smoke suppressant, comprising the following components in percentage by weight: 7%-9% of a warm mixing agent and 91%-93% of aluminium hydroxide subjected to surface modification treatment. The invention also discloses a preparation method of smoke-suppressing asphalt. The method comprises the following steps: a) heating asphalt to 100-130 DEG C, and then adding the warm mixing agent in the smoke suppressant according to the ratio in claim 1, and stirring until the warm mixing agent is uniform; and b) adding the aluminium hydroxide subjected to surface modification treatment, and stirring until the aluminium hydroxide is uniform, wherein the percentage of the asphalt is 95%-97%, and the percentage of the smoke suppressant is 3%-5%. According to the smoke suppressant disclosed by the invention, release of asphalt smoke in the construction process of a hot mix asphalt pavement can be obviously reduced, the mixing temperature of the smoke suppressant is low, the construction and ecological environments are greatly improved, the physical health of constructors is protected, the smoke suppressant has significant social benefits and environmental protection benefits, meanwhile, energy conservation can also be achieved, asphalt ageing is relieved, the pavement performances such as the integrality, the strength and the durability of the asphalt pavement are improved, and the smoke suppressant has obvious technical and economic benefits.
